Transaction 2cac5a36331ea67cb42058da20f15cd77c4630e4d1770e166d863ab5d3cdecb5
1 Input
1 Output
-
2cac5a36331ea67cb42058da20f15cd77c4630e4d1770e166d863ab5d3cdecb5:0
- value
- 3662703
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80832cb504abdf645c844672c4e20c93b84ef3d5 OP_EQUAL
- address
- 3DQXZGhyM86mK3zPmUhARAve9gEokMc47J